Transaction

a937341f34098877cc8b261224fd2681033da3f70c4b564765f4a9a999ccb6af

Summary

In Block173473
TimeSun, 07 May 2023 19:06:15 UTC
Total Input964.71419271 Nebula
Total Output1019.71419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
710907 Confirmations1019.71419271 Nebula
Raw Transaction